
Workington Town coach Jonty Gorley has made two changes to his squad of 21 for Sunday’s home game with Midlands Hurricanes.
Mason Lewthwaite and Steve Scholey are replaced by Toby Gibson and Guy Graham from the squad originally named for the Good Friday derby at Whitehaven.
Both Lewthwaite and Scholey started in the 22-14 win at the Ortus Rec.
Town were recording their second Championship win of the season to move onto five points in 14th place, some eight points behind the Midlands side who have won six of their nine games so far.
Last Sunday they were 56-18 winners at North Wales Crusaders, who since then have announced the owners had quit and that the players had not been paid on time.
But the Hurricanes continue to flourish and have made only once change to the 21-strong squad that was named ahead of the trip to Colwyn Bay with Lewis Else replaced by Chris Cullimore.
